The Christopher Knight Home Hallandale 7-Piece Aluminum Dining Set addresses the most common frustration with outdoor dining furniture in the $500-800 tier: chairs that flex, tables that wobble after one season, and powder coats that flake after prolonged sun exposure. At $1,200+, the Hallandale moves to thicker-gauge aluminum framing and a more durable surface finish — the kind of build that holds up for years of outdoor use rather than requiring replacement every two to three seasons. In the patio set market, Christopher Knight Home occupies a useful gap: more substantial construction than big-box patio sets, but well below the pricing of hospitality-grade outdoor furniture from brands like Telescope Casual or Brown Jordan. The 7-piece scope — table plus six chairs — covers a full outdoor entertaining setup without the mismatched pieces that result from adding chairs separately. The aluminum frame stays cool to the touch in direct sun, which matters when chairs get pushed back across a hot patio. Assembly is easier with two people for table base alignment, and seat cushions benefit from covers or indoor storage to preserve upholstery through multiple seasons. For buyers wanting a complete, high-quality outdoor dining setup that holds its appearance across years, the Hallandale delivers at a price well below the premium outdoor furniture market.

Nine-piece outdoor dining at $380 earns Best Value 9-Piece at rank 2 on this patio set comparison: Devoko's rattan-and-glass configuration delivers 8 chairs and a full dining table — the most complete group dining setup on the page at the second-lowest price. Rattan weave construction maintains structural integrity across seasons; the glass dining surface provides a smooth, easy-to-clean table top that metal and resin alternatives at lower prices typically do not. Against the Christopher Knight Home Hallandale ($1233.33 rank 1), the Devoko costs $853 less for a comparable piece count — CKH's premium materials and manufacturing quality are the differentiators at triple the price, relevant for buyers who want furniture that lasts 10+ seasons rather than 3-5. Against Best Choice Products 4-Piece ($219.98 rank 3), the Devoko costs $160 more for more than double the seating — value case is strongest when hosting 6-8 people regularly. Against the Tangkula Bistro 3-Piece ($189.99 rank 5), the Devoko costs $190 more for a full 9-piece dining configuration versus the Tangkula's compact 2-chair bistro format. The tempered glass top is rain-resistant but benefits from cover during prolonged rain or winter storage to maintain appearance. Assembly with 9 components requires 2-3 hours and two people. Choose the Devoko when maximum outdoor dining capacity at budget pricing is the priority and multi-year extreme-weather durability is less critical.

Tangkula's 3-piece bistro set at $189.99 uses a mosaic tile tabletop that serves both decorative and functional purposes: the tile surface resists heat from direct sun without warping or fading, and wipes clean with a damp cloth rather than requiring the maintenance that teak or cedar tabletops need. Folding chairs collapse flat for compact storage against a wall or in a closet during off-season periods — relevant for balcony or small patio users without dedicated outdoor storage. At $189.99, this is the entry option on a page where the Christopher Knight premium set runs $1,233.33 and the Devoko 9-piece dining set at $379.99 occupies the mid-tier. The trade-off is scale: the bistro format seats two, appropriate for a couple's meals or morning coffee but not a family dining setup. The mosaic tile adds visible character that standard aluminum or resin tops don't deliver, making the Tangkula appropriate for buyers who want a visually interesting piece rather than a utilitarian outdoor table. Tile can chip if heavy objects are set down hard — treat it as a dining surface, not a work surface.
